* Section 9-314A. Perfection by Possession and Control of Chattel Paper.\n (a) Perfection by possession and control. A secured party may perfect\na security interest in chattel paper by taking possession of each\nauthoritative tangible copy of the record evidencing the chattel paper\nand obtaining control of each authoritative electronic copy of the\nelectronic record evidencing the chattel paper.\n (b) Time of perfection; continuation of perfection. A security\ninterest is perfected under subsection (a) not earlier than the time the\nsecured party takes possession and obtains control and remains perfected\nunder subsection (a) only while the secured party retains possession and\ncontrol.\n (c) Application of Section 9--313 to perfection by possession of\nchattel paper.
